Transaction 25a07f5ce6749e9f408f899e333f05b749b108550a496e99364e315e4a767e67
1 Input
1 Output
-
25a07f5ce6749e9f408f899e333f05b749b108550a496e99364e315e4a767e67:0
- value
- 511917
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1da52f7d9e1ff8048ac8c7d62d33839f783a1e90 OP_EQUAL
- address
- 34PmQPzq5sR635R6C75CYSp6Vu79EwuMhg